description Product Description
This compound is primarily utilized in the synthesis of antiviral drugs, particularly those targeting viral infections such as hepatitis B and HIV. Its unique structure allows it to act as a nucleoside analogue, inhibiting viral replication by interfering with the viral RNA or DNA synthesis. Additionally, it is employed in research and development for designing new therapeutic agents due to its ability to mimic natural nucleosides, making it a valuable building block in medicinal chemistry. Its applications extend to the study of enzyme mechanisms and the development of enzyme inhibitors, contributing to advancements in biochemistry and pharmacology.
